Lessons available for pet whispering

EDINBURGH, Scotland -- Scientists at the University of Edinburgh have unveiled a course enabling pet owners to understand what their animals need, The Scotsman reported Friday. Once only the realm of Dr. Dolittle or horse-whisperer Robert Redford, the CD-based distance learning pack will provide pet owners with information on the fundamentals of animal behavior and how to cope with problems that arise. The courses cover a range of pets including dogs, cats, rabbits, guinea pigs, hamsters, horses, parrots and exotic species such as iguanas. Course organizer Dr Shirley Seaman said many people do not understand how their pets behave. "This course will help explain the fundamentals of animal behavior, how the behavior of companion animals is affected by the environment in which they are kept, and how this can lead to the development of problems." The companion animal behavior and welfare course was developed by experts from the Animal Behavior and Welfare Group at the University's Royal School of Veterinary Studies.
